Close your Exercise ring by completing at least 30 minutes of activity at or above a brisk walk. The Exercise ring shows how many minutes of brisk activity you’ve completed, whether you’re just moving at a fast pace or doing a specific workout in the Workout app. All at once or a little at a time, you can earn Exercise minutes however it ...

The Stand, Exercise, and Move rings make up the central display for your overall activity as captured by your Apple Watch. Scrolling down in the Activity app on your watch will show you an hour-by-hour breakdown of your activity for each (when you've moved, when you've recorded exercise minutes, and when you've stood).

Tap "Next" one more time to adjust your Stand goal, in hour increments. The ability to change your Exercise and Stand goals was added to the Apple Watch with the arrival of watchOS 7 in September 2020. Prior to this, you could only change your Move goal. In this video, we break down ...Wrist Tattoos Can Affect Apple Watch Exercise Tracking. After many people with wrist tattoos reported having some issues tracking their workouts, Apple confirmed that inked skin might interfere with the watch's sensors. Try wearing your watch on your other wrist if it's free of tattoos.
